The evolution of Chanel is a fascinating journey that showcases the brand's ability to balance timeless elegance with a spirit of playful rebellion. Founded by the visionary Coco Chanel in the early 20th century, the fashion house quickly disrupted the status quo, liberating women from the constraints of corseted silhouettes. This bold departure from tradition not only introduced the iconic little black dress but also championed the idea that comfort and sophistication could coexist. As Chanel’s designs evolved over the decades, they echoed prevailing social changes and the shifting attitudes towards femininity, making the brand a resonant symbol of empowerment.
In recent years, Chanel has continued to embody this duality, merging classic elements with contemporary flair. Under the creative direction of influential designers like Karl Lagerfeld and, more recently, Virginie Viard, the brand has embraced a sense of playful rebellion while maintaining its elegant roots. Collections often feature a mix of structured tailoring and whimsical motifs, and limited-edition collaborations push the envelope of luxury fashion. This dynamic evolution reflects not only the brand's adaptability but also its commitment to creating garments that resonate with a modern audience.
Chanel's iconic pieces have long transcended mere fashion; they embody a unique blend of sophistication and playful rebellion. From the timeless Chanel No. 5 perfume to the quintessential Chanel Suit, these creations are more than just clothing or fragrance—they are symbols of a bold, independent spirit. The famous interlocking CC logo serves not only as a mark of luxury but also as a testament to Coco Chanel's legacy of challenging the norms of femininity and elegance. Each piece invites wearers to embrace their individuality while indulging in the exquisite craftsmanship that Chanel is renowned for.
One can't discuss Chanel's iconic pieces without mentioning the legendary quilted handbag. This accessory perfectly encapsulates sophisticated mischief—a fusion of practicality and style that has become a staple in fashion. With its rich heritage and status as a status symbol, the bag's enduring appeal lies in its versatility, seamlessly transitioning from day to night. Other notable mentions include the little black dress and the Camellia flower motif, both of which exemplify Chanel's ability to blend elegance with a touch of playfulness, making her designs timeless yet endlessly innovative.
